I don't think they were disagreeing with you, I think they were just trying to say:

You shouldn't need braces to be vertically aligned if your code is uniformly indented. Then you can easily see what code is paired together just by their indentation level.

Of course this is not always true if you've got a bunch of crazy nested indentation pushing things off to the right.
